#DC8EEA Hex Color Code

#DC8EEA

The Hexadecimal Color #DC8EEA is a contrast shade of Violet. #DC8EEA RGB value is rgb(220, 142, 234). RGB Color Model of #DC8EEA consists of 86% red, 55% green and 91% blue. HSL color Mode of #DC8EEA has 291°(degrees) Hue, 69% Saturation and 74% Lightness. #DC8EEA color has an wavelength of 436.77778n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#DC8EEA is #FF99F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#DC8EEA is #D8E. The Closest Color to #DC8EEA is #EE82EE. Official Name of #DC8EEA Hex Code is Lavender Magenta.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#DC8EEA is 6 Cyan 39 Magenta 0 Yellow 8 Black and #DC8EEA CMY is 6, 39,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#DC8EEA is hsl(291,69,74,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(291, 39, 92).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#DC8EEA is 54.04, 40.5, 82.8.
Hex8 Value of #DC8EEA is #DC8EEAFF. Decimal Value of #DC8EEA is 14454506 and Octal Value of #DC8EEA is 67107352. Binary Value of #DC8EEA is 11011100, 10001110, 11101010 and Android of #DC8EEA is 4292644586 / 0xffdc8eea.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#DC8EEA is 0.305, 0.228, 0.228 and YIQ Color Space of #DC8EEA is 175.81, 16.9206, 45.1274.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#DC8EEA is 43.55, 31.23, 82.14.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#DC8EEA is 69.82, 44.29, -34.58.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#DC8EEA is 69.82, 36.05, -61.52.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#DC8EEA is 69.82, 56.19, 322.02. Hunter Lab variable of #DC8EEA is 63.64, 40.21, -32.59.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#DC8EEA

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
